Nostalgia and Modern Influences
Musically, "Boy for the Weekend" draws from a rich palette. With its upbeat tempo and infectious chorus, it feels like a modern twist on the classic summer hits of the past. The production, layered with shimmering synths and a groovy bassline, evokes a sense of nostalgia, reminiscent of tracks that dominated the airwaves during carefree summers.
Indigo has cited his musical influences as significant in shaping his sound, mentioning artists like Bruno Mars and the Isley Brothers, whom he grew up listening to in Honolulu.
The connection to his childhood is evident in the way Indigo crafts his melodies. As a young performer in a local group, he absorbed the essence of soulful pop, which now permeates his music. The infectious energy of "Boy for the Weekend" channels that same spirit, making it a perfect addition to summer playlists.
